The Sun-Times’ experts offer their picks for the Bears’ game Sunday at the Raiders (3:25 p.m., CBS 2):
Patrick Finley
Raiders, 28-27: The Bears have played 21 games in the Pacific time zone this century. They’ve lost two-thirds of them and have covered the point spread only eight times. Their last win out west came Dec. 26, 2021, with Nick Foles at quarterback. This year: 3-0
Jason Lieser
Bears, 33-24: The Raiders simply aren’t doing much right. They have potential with an explosive runner in Ashton Jeanty and a savvy quarterback in Geno Smith, but this is a team the Bears should be able to handle. This year: 1-2
Mark Potash
Bears, 23-21: Caleb Williams and the Bears’ offense will face a bigger challenge on the road against the Raiders’ defense. Beware the hiccup, but the Bears are playing with confidence and figure to keep getting better under Ben Johnson. This year: 3-0
Steve Greenberg
Bears, 24-20: When was the last time you publicly predicted a road win for a team with a 1-10 record in its last 11 games away from home? Yeah, well, I don’t feel great about it, either. If these teams played 10 times, they’d each manage to win fewer than five. Don’t ask me to explain the math. OK, Geno Smith, let’s see those interceptions. This year: 3-0
Scoop Jackson
Bears, 33-21: In three games teams have out-rushed the Raiders by 125 yards. If the Bears continue that ground game trend, they’ll go into the bye week staring .500 straight in its face. This year: 1-2

The sale was from the McKenna estate to the existing owners and doesn’t change the ownership structure of the franchise. The McCaskey family now own 77% of the team, and the Ryan family owns the rest.
